Russia has pounded Ukrainian forces with airstrikes and artillery in the east and south, targeting command centers, troops and ammunition depots, the Russian Defense Ministry said on Sunday, informing of the war.

According to Reuters, Lt. Gen. Igor Konashenkov, a spokesman for the Ministry of Defense, said that the rockets fired from the air hit three command points, 13 areas where troops and Ukrainian military equipment were gathered, as well as four ammunition depots in Don.

In southern Ukraine, and in particular in Nikolaev, Russian missiles hit a mobile anti-drone system near the village of Hanivka, about 100 km northeast of the city of Nikolaev, Konashenkov said.

The rockets and artillery hit 583 areas where troops and Ukrainian military equipment were concentrated, 41 checkpoints, 76 artillery and mortar units at firing points, including three Grad artillery units, and a Ukrainian electronic warfare station near Bukovel (anti-drone). “Hanivka settlement, in the Nikolaev area,” he said.

Russia has destroyed 174 aircraft, 125 helicopters, 977 drones, 317 anti-aircraft missile systems, 3,198 tanks and 40 armored vehicles and 40 armored vehicles since the launch of the “special military operation”, as Moscow calls it, on February 24. multiple missiles, Konashenkov said.

The Ukrainians are talking about 7 civilians killed in Donetsk

Ukrainian authorities on Saturday accused the Russian armed forces of killing seven civilians in the Donetsk region, in the eastern part of the war-torn country under Moscow control.

The three were killed in the city of Liman, Ukrainian Governor Pavlo Kirilenko said via the Telegram platform. He did not say exactly how they lost their lives.

Seven other people were injured, according to the same official, who said “every war criminal will be punished.”

Meanwhile in Kherson, a city occupied by the Russian armed forces, local pro-Russian officials accused the Ukrainian armed forces via Telegram of killing three civilians and wounding ten others in the village of Biloserka, without giving further details.

It is impossible to verify this information independently.

78 women among the captives handed over to Azofstal

Among the captives handed over to the Russian armed forces at the Azofstal steel plant in the port of Mariupol are 78 women, said a pro-Russian separatist leader of the self-proclaimed Donetsk People’s Republic.

The detainees also include foreigners, according to Dennis Pushilin, who spoke to Russia’s state-run TASS news agency. He did not specify how many, nor their nationalities.

“They had enough food and water, they also had enough weapons. The problem was the lack of medicine,” said Mr Pushilin. He said six Ukrainian soldiers had been killed trying to blow up stored ammunition before being captured.
